    Exclamation Harvey ST 1400 Sliding Table Attachment

    I’d like to know if anyone has any experience using the above Table Saw Attachment. I’ve finally decided to buy the Harvey HW110LGE-30 Table saw. I’m seriously considering buying the TS Attachment as well, but can’t find any details/reviews by anyone currently owning one. Can anyone help?

    Welcome aboard ...

    Harvey saws are sold in the US as Grizzly saws ... infact if you get a Harvey then download the Grizzley G0690 manual ... it's much better

    Youtube has a bunch of videos on the Grizzly T10223 sliding attachment.

    I would get it if I had the space ... saves making sleds
